Alpha Kappa Psi (AKPsi), Rho Chapter
AKPsi is the oldest business-focused organization at the University of Washington and the Foster School of Business, with a rich history around the Pacific Northwest. It aims to provide resources for enhancing the educational experiences of future business leaders.
I rushed Alpha Kappa Psi in Autumn, 2013. During the pledge process, I served as the fundraising chair and led a team of 5 to raise $1000 in 8 weeks. I was also a member of the Professional Development team and designed and facilitated multiple events, such as Northwest Mutual case competition, guests speeches, etc. In the Autumn Quarter of 2014, I served as a consultant for Rho Consulting and 8 of us worked with a Non-Profit Organization in Seattle- Legal Voice to identify the current marketing problems within the institution and found out the solutions. Moreover, during my active participating through various events such as Regional conference, Relay For Life, etc., I absorbed a totally different way of thinking and seeing the issues through the lens of businesses and I have learned a lot of great ideas and perspectives from my peers.

Learning and Reasoning:
Idea Generation
- Creating ideas by expanding one's thinking beyond the convention to best address the issue. It is a creative process of constructing idea, innovating the concepts, and bring this idea to the reality.
- During the pledge process, the chapter set a goal of a certain amount of money to achieve in order to demonstrate our fundraising and leadership ability. As the fundraising chair, I led my committee members to brainstorm various ideas to generate funds. One of the ideas was to take professional head shots for students at the University. The idea was executed successfully and we had more than 100 people get their photo taken. This was a great idea that was different than the rest of the ideas that the previous pledge classes had. In the constant changing world, idea generation is essential in order to find the best ideas to reach the solution and achieve the goal.
